New information and the final design of the Apple 14 Pro and Pro Max have been leaked.

The official release of the new generation iPhone is still several months away, but leaks continue one after the other. Specifically, new revelations about the upgraded camera system of the upcoming flagship devices, the complete CAD render of the Pro Max, and detailed designs of the iPhone 14 Pro have just been released, with detailed information about their dimensions.

The leaker ShrimpApplePro was the first to leak the design of the two upcoming iPhones. According to the renders, the bezels of the iPhone 14 Pro Max will reach 1.95mm from 2.42 mm, that is 20% smaller than the iPhone 13 Pro Max, making them the thinnest we have seen so far on a smartphone. Responding to the demands of its fans, Apple has made a change that has not occurred since 2017, with the release of the iPhone X. This will result in a larger screen-to-body ratio. The screen will reach 6.7 inches and its dimensions will be 160.7 mm in height, 78.53 mm in width including the side buttons, and 12.16 mm in depth including the rear camera. The Pro, on the other hand, will have a depth of 7.85 mm, a width of 71.45 mm and a height of 147.46 mm.

The camera bump, as already mentioned, is expected to be larger for both devices, as Apple is going to use a 45MP main sensor, instead of the 12MP sensor that we have seen so far. Analyst Ming-Chi Kuo recently stated that the camera of Apple’s new flagships will be 25% to 30% larger. New information from the Chinese social network Weibo and detailed representations reinforce this claim.

Rumors regarding the camera also state that the sensor manufactured by Sony will have dual pixel auto focus (DPAF) technology and the ability to record 16:9 HDR video at 60 fps. Its size will reach 1/1.3 inches, increased by 21.2% compared with the 1/1.65 inch sensor of the iPhone 13 Pro and Pro Max. In addition, the iPhone 14 Pro Max and iPhone 14 Pro are expected to be the first mobiles with fully symmetrical frames, on all sides of the screen, thanks to the removal of the notch and the introduction of the new dual punch hole layout for the front camera and face id. The specific layout is claimed to reach 7.15 mm for the pill shape and 5.59 mm for the punch hole. In terms of technology, the screen is expected to have a 120Hz ProMotion image refresh rate.

Some more information we learned is that both devices are expected to have USB-C connectivity and the whole line up of the series 14 will have 6GB of memory, with entry level models having LPDDR 4X technology and flagships having LPDDR 5. The Pro and Pro Max models are said to have an A16 processor, but the company is rumored to be facing difficulties in obtaining this particular chipset.
